From c372044e2081581bcf7df4969ea33552ad3bd9d8 Mon Sep 17 00:00:00 2001
From: lsh <lsh@163.com>
Date: 星期三, 12 六月 2024 11:12:58 +0800
Subject: [PATCH] #

---
 src/main/java/com/zy/common/properties/SystemProperties.java |    3 +
 src/main/java/com/zy/common/task/ActivateScheduler.java      |    4 +-
 src/main/java/com/zy/asrs/utils/Utils.java                   |   47 ++++++++++-------------
 src/main/java/com/zy/common/config/AdminInterceptor.java     |   14 +++---
 src/main/java/com/zy/common/service/CommonService.java       |    2 
 src/main/java/com/zy/common/CodeBuilder.java                 |    4 +-
 6 files changed, 34 insertions(+), 40 deletions(-)

diff --git a/src/main/java/com/zy/asrs/utils/Utils.java b/src/main/java/com/zy/asrs/utils/Utils.java
index 2109368..34b1dc7 100644
--- a/src/main/java/com/zy/asrs/utils/Utils.java
+++ b/src/main/java/com/zy/asrs/utils/Utils.java
@@ -279,30 +279,31 @@
 
     //搴撲綅鎺掑彿鍒嗛厤
     public static int[] LocNecessaryParameters(Integer whsType, Integer curRow, Integer crnNumber) {
+        RowLastnoService rowLastnoService = SpringUtils.getBean(RowLastnoService.class);
+        RowLastno rowLastno = rowLastnoService.selectById(whsType);
         switch (whsType){
             case 1://缁忓吀鍙屼几搴撲綅
-                return LocNecessaryParametersDoubleExtension(whsType, curRow, crnNumber); //宸插畬鍠�
+                return LocNecessaryParametersDoubleExtension(rowLastno, curRow, crnNumber); //宸插畬鍠�
             case 2://缁忓吀鍗曚几搴撲綅锛�2鎺掕揣鏋讹級
-                return LocNecessaryParametersDoubleExtension2(whsType, curRow, crnNumber); //宸插畬鍠�
+                return LocNecessaryParametersDoubleExtension2(rowLastno, curRow, crnNumber); //宸插畬鍠�
             case 3://缁忓吀鍗曞弻浼稿簱浣�  宸﹀崟鍙冲弻(灏忓崟澶у弻)
-                return LocNecessaryParametersDoubleExtension3(whsType, curRow, crnNumber); //鏈畬鍠�
+                return LocNecessaryParametersDoubleExtension3(rowLastno, curRow, crnNumber); //鏈畬鍠�
             case 4://缁忓吀鍗曞弻浼稿簱浣�  宸﹀弻鍙冲崟(灏忓弻澶у崟)
-                return LocNecessaryParametersDoubleExtension4(whsType, curRow, crnNumber); //鏈畬鍠�
+                return LocNecessaryParametersDoubleExtension4(rowLastno, curRow, crnNumber); //鏈畬鍠�
             case 5://鍙屽伐浣嶅崟浼稿簱浣�(4鎺掕揣鏋�)
-                return LocNecessaryParametersDoubleExtension5(whsType, curRow, crnNumber); //宸插畬鍠�
+                return LocNecessaryParametersDoubleExtension5(rowLastno, curRow, crnNumber); //宸插畬鍠�
             default:
-                return LocNecessaryParametersMove(whsType, curRow, crnNumber);//moveCrnNo
+                return LocNecessaryParametersMove(rowLastno, curRow, crnNumber);//moveCrnNo
         }
     }
 
     //缁忓吀鍙屼几搴撲綅
-    public static int[] LocNecessaryParametersDoubleExtension(Integer whsType, Integer curRow, Integer crnNumber) {
+    public static int[] LocNecessaryParametersDoubleExtension(RowLastno rowLastno, Integer curRow, Integer crnNumber) {
         int[] necessaryParameters = new int[]{0, 0, 0, 0};
-        RowLastnoService rowLastnoService = SpringUtils.getBean(RowLastnoService.class);
-        RowLastno rowLastno = rowLastnoService.selectById(whsType);
+
         Integer sRow = rowLastno.getsRow();
         Integer sCrnNo = rowLastno.getsCrnNo();
-        if (BooleanWhsTypeSta(whsType)) {
+        if (BooleanWhsTypeSta(rowLastno.getWhsType())) {
             necessaryParameters[0] = crnNumber; // 杞娆℃暟
             //婊℃澘姝e父鍏ュ簱
             if (curRow.equals(crnNumber * 4 + sRow - 1)) {
@@ -335,7 +336,7 @@
     }
 
     //缁忓吀鍙屼几搴撲綅绉诲簱
-    public static int[] LocNecessaryParametersMove(Integer whsType, Integer curRow, Integer moveCrnNo) {
+    public static int[] LocNecessaryParametersMove(RowLastno rowLastno, Integer curRow, Integer moveCrnNo) {
         int[] necessaryParameters = new int[]{0, 0, 0, 0};
         necessaryParameters[0] = 2; // 杞娆℃暟
         if (curRow.equals(moveCrnNo*4-2)){
@@ -351,13 +352,11 @@
     }
 
     //缁忓吀鍗曚几搴撲綅
-    public static int[] LocNecessaryParametersDoubleExtension2(Integer whsType, Integer curRow, Integer crnNumber) {
+    public static int[] LocNecessaryParametersDoubleExtension2(RowLastno rowLastno, Integer curRow, Integer crnNumber) {
         int[] necessaryParameters = new int[]{0, 0, 0, 0};
-        RowLastnoService rowLastnoService = SpringUtils.getBean(RowLastnoService.class);
-        RowLastno rowLastno = rowLastnoService.selectById(whsType);
         Integer sRow = rowLastno.getsRow();
         Integer sCrnNo = rowLastno.getsCrnNo();
-        if (BooleanWhsTypeSta(whsType)) {
+        if (BooleanWhsTypeSta(rowLastno.getWhsType())) {
             necessaryParameters[0] = crnNumber; // 杞娆℃暟
             //婊℃澘姝e父鍏ュ簱
             if (curRow.equals(crnNumber * 2 + sRow - 1)) {
@@ -390,13 +389,11 @@
     }
 
     //缁忓吀鍗曞弻浼稿簱浣�  宸﹀崟鍙冲弻(灏忓崟澶у弻)
-    public static int[] LocNecessaryParametersDoubleExtension3(Integer whsType, Integer curRow, Integer crnNumber) {
+    public static int[] LocNecessaryParametersDoubleExtension3(RowLastno rowLastno, Integer curRow, Integer crnNumber) {
         int[] necessaryParameters = new int[]{0, 0, 0, 0};
-        RowLastnoService rowLastnoService = SpringUtils.getBean(RowLastnoService.class);
-        RowLastno rowLastno = rowLastnoService.selectById(whsType);
         Integer sRow = rowLastno.getsRow();
         Integer sCrnNo = rowLastno.getsCrnNo();
-        if (BooleanWhsTypeSta(whsType)) {
+        if (BooleanWhsTypeSta(rowLastno.getWhsType())) {
             necessaryParameters[0] = crnNumber; // 杞娆℃暟
             //婊℃澘姝e父鍏ュ簱
             if (curRow.equals(crnNumber * 3 + sRow - 1)) {
@@ -429,13 +426,11 @@
     }
 
     //缁忓吀鍗曞弻浼稿簱浣�  宸﹀弻鍙冲崟(灏忓弻澶у崟)
-    public static int[] LocNecessaryParametersDoubleExtension4(Integer whsType, Integer curRow, Integer crnNumber) {
+    public static int[] LocNecessaryParametersDoubleExtension4(RowLastno rowLastno, Integer curRow, Integer crnNumber) {
         int[] necessaryParameters = new int[]{0, 0, 0, 0};
-        RowLastnoService rowLastnoService = SpringUtils.getBean(RowLastnoService.class);
-        RowLastno rowLastno = rowLastnoService.selectById(whsType);
         Integer sRow = rowLastno.getsRow();
         Integer sCrnNo = rowLastno.getsCrnNo();
-        if (BooleanWhsTypeSta(whsType)) {
+        if (BooleanWhsTypeSta(rowLastno.getWhsType())) {
             necessaryParameters[0] = crnNumber; // 杞娆℃暟
             //婊℃澘姝e父鍏ュ簱
             if (curRow.equals(crnNumber * 3 + sRow - 1)) {
@@ -468,13 +463,11 @@
     }
 
     //鍙屽伐浣嶅崟浼稿簱浣�
-    public static int[] LocNecessaryParametersDoubleExtension5(Integer whsType, Integer curRow, Integer crnNumber) {
+    public static int[] LocNecessaryParametersDoubleExtension5(RowLastno rowLastno, Integer curRow, Integer crnNumber) {
         int[] necessaryParameters = new int[]{0, 0, 0, 0};
-        RowLastnoService rowLastnoService = SpringUtils.getBean(RowLastnoService.class);
-        RowLastno rowLastno = rowLastnoService.selectById(whsType);
         Integer sRow = rowLastno.getsRow();
         Integer sCrnNo = rowLastno.getsCrnNo();
-        if (BooleanWhsTypeSta(whsType)) {
+        if (BooleanWhsTypeSta(rowLastno.getWhsType())) {
             necessaryParameters[0] = crnNumber; // 杞娆℃暟
             //婊℃澘姝e父鍏ュ簱
             if (curRow.equals(crnNumber * 4 + sRow - 1)) {
diff --git a/src/main/java/com/zy/common/CodeBuilder.java b/src/main/java/com/zy/common/CodeBuilder.java
index 99dada9..47f63a4 100644
--- a/src/main/java/com/zy/common/CodeBuilder.java
+++ b/src/main/java/com/zy/common/CodeBuilder.java
@@ -17,10 +17,10 @@
 //        generator.table="sys_host";
         // sqlserver
         generator.sqlOsType = SqlOsType.SQL_SERVER;
-        generator.url="192.168.4.15:1433;databasename=gdykasrs";
+        generator.url="192.168.4.15:1433;databasename=source";
         generator.username="sa";
         generator.password="sa@123";
-        generator.table="man_auto_move";
+        generator.table="asr_row_lastno_type";
         generator.packagePath="com.zy.asrs";
         generator.build();
     }
diff --git a/src/main/java/com/zy/common/config/AdminInterceptor.java b/src/main/java/com/zy/common/config/AdminInterceptor.java
index 1bc1838..547ba96 100644
--- a/src/main/java/com/zy/common/config/AdminInterceptor.java
+++ b/src/main/java/com/zy/common/config/AdminInterceptor.java
@@ -141,13 +141,13 @@
                     Http.response(response, BaseRes.NO_ACTIVATION);
                     return false;
                 }
-                // 璁板綍鎿嶄綔鏃ュ織
-                OperateLog operateLog = new OperateLog();
-                operateLog.setAction(Cools.isEmpty(memo)?request.getRequestURI():memo);
-                operateLog.setIp(request.getRemoteAddr());
-                operateLog.setUserId(user.getId());
-                operateLog.setRequest(JSON.toJSONString(request.getParameterMap()));
-                request.setAttribute("operateLog", operateLog);
+//                // 璁板綍鎿嶄綔鏃ュ織
+//                OperateLog operateLog = new OperateLog();
+//                operateLog.setAction(Cools.isEmpty(memo)?request.getRequestURI():memo);
+//                operateLog.setIp(request.getRemoteAddr());
+//                operateLog.setUserId(user.getId());
+//                operateLog.setRequest(JSON.toJSONString(request.getParameterMap()));
+//                request.setAttribute("operateLog", operateLog);
             }
             return true;
         } catch (Exception e){
diff --git a/src/main/java/com/zy/common/properties/SystemProperties.java b/src/main/java/com/zy/common/properties/SystemProperties.java
index ba6350b..b693d42 100644
--- a/src/main/java/com/zy/common/properties/SystemProperties.java
+++ b/src/main/java/com/zy/common/properties/SystemProperties.java
@@ -15,7 +15,8 @@
     public static final String SALT = "123456789qwertyu";
 
     // 绯荤粺婵�娲荤姸鎬� (榛樿鏈縺娲�)
-    public static boolean SYSTEM_ACTIVATION = Boolean.FALSE;
+//    public static boolean SYSTEM_ACTIVATION = Boolean.FALSE;
+    public static boolean SYSTEM_ACTIVATION = Boolean.TRUE;
 
     public static String getActivationCode(String fileName){
         StringBuilder activationCode = new StringBuilder();
diff --git a/src/main/java/com/zy/common/service/CommonService.java b/src/main/java/com/zy/common/service/CommonService.java
index eb95817..cbc3cbe 100644
--- a/src/main/java/com/zy/common/service/CommonService.java
+++ b/src/main/java/com/zy/common/service/CommonService.java
@@ -137,7 +137,7 @@
         if (Cools.isEmpty(matnr)) {  //鐗╂枡鍙�
             matnr = "";
         }
-        if (Cools.isEmpty(batch)) {  //绠卞彿
+        if (Cools.isEmpty(batch)) {  //鎵规
             batch = "";
         }
         if (Cools.isEmpty(grade)) {  //澶囩敤
diff --git a/src/main/java/com/zy/common/task/ActivateScheduler.java b/src/main/java/com/zy/common/task/ActivateScheduler.java
index 4b96119..22b0ff0 100644
--- a/src/main/java/com/zy/common/task/ActivateScheduler.java
+++ b/src/main/java/com/zy/common/task/ActivateScheduler.java
@@ -18,8 +18,8 @@
 public class ActivateScheduler {
 
 //    @Scheduled(cron = "0/1 * 8 * * ? ") // 姣忓ぉ8鐐�
-    @Scheduled(cron = "* 0/1 * * * ? ") // 姣忓垎閽�
-    @PostConstruct
+//    @Scheduled(cron = "* 0/1 * * * ? ") // 姣忓垎閽�
+//    @PostConstruct
     private void execute(){
         // 鑾峰彇婵�娲荤爜
         String activationCode = SystemProperties.getActivationCode(OSinfo.getOSname().getActivationCodePath());

--
Gitblit v1.9.1